the details: a few essentials for beautiful minimalist interiors

Design is in the details.  I believe this.  In modern design, the best details are the ones that appear simple. 

I say appear, because usually much more precision and attention to craft needs occur in order for them to be executed properly.

To achieve the minimalist, clean aesthetic often demands veering from the path of standard construction methods.  Items that must be left behind: trim, filler panels, coverplates and other ways of hiding less than perfect construction.

1. Bocci Collection 22: wall accessories | trimless outlets for power, data, phone and switching

2. i-LeD: technical series, :  trimless, recessed LED ceiling lights | energy efficient, minimal with a variety of sizes and applications

3. Lutron: lighting controls and systems (you can even control your lights remotely with your iphone!)

4. Architectural Devices:  Modern Smoke Detector | beautiful trimless flush-mounted smoke-detector

5. Quick Drain: Lineal Drains | 1 1/2" wide linear drains with a variety of cover grills (so much better than the typical center drain!)

6. Mecho-shade: manual and motorized shading systems | these are beautiful recessed + motorized!

 7. Amina: invisible wall/ceiling speakers | totally concealed in-wall audio speakers
